What problems show up on the 2008 GMC Acadia?
211 of 852 filings named Transmission / driveline (25% of the file). That is what owners wrote, not a shop diagnosis of the vehicle in the driveway.
Second is Steering (102 reports).
There are 5 official safety recalls on this year. They were filed about Glass / wipers / cameras, Airbags, and Body / frame. Check the VIN at nhtsa.gov — a campaign on this page can still be open on a specific truck.
The 2007 has 423 reports on file; this year has 852. Older years collect more reports just by being on the road longer. If you need a fairer comparison, use the equal-time view.

Which systems owners named
Share of owner complaints filed against each vehicle system. These shares are not adjusted for how many vehicles were sold.
“Unclassified NHTSA leftover” is not a car part. It is a filing bucket and always sits last.
View component data as a table
| System / Component | Complaints | Share of Reports | Safety Reports (Crashes / Fires)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Transmission / driveline (POWER TRAIN) | 211 | 24.8% | 1 crashes · 0 fires |
| Steering (STEERING) | 102 | 12.0% | 5 crashes · 2 fires |
| Airbags (AIR BAGS) | 91 | 10.7% | 5 crashes · 0 fires |
| Engine (ENGINE) | 89 | 10.5% | 0 crashes · 4 fires |
| Electrical (ELECTRICAL SYSTEM) | 72 | 8.4% | 2 crashes · 1 fires |
| Body / frame (STRUCTURE) | 63 | 7.4% | 1 crashes · 1 fires |
| Lights (EXTERIOR LIGHTING) | 45 | 5.3% | 0 crashes · 4 fires |
| Glass / wipers / cameras (VISIBILITY) | 24 | 2.8% | 0 crashes · 0 fires |
| Cruise / speed control (V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L) | 19 | 2.2% | 2 crashes · 0 fires |
| Unclassified NHTSA leftover | 163 | 19.1% | 3 crashes · 2 fires |

Safety Recalls (5)
Official campaigns. Each one says what could go wrong and what the dealer was told to fix.
In short, these campaigns were filed about Glass / wipers / cameras, Airbags, and Body / frame.
-
Recall campaign 08V410000
Glass / wipers / cameras
- Report date
- Component:
- Glass / wipers / cameras (VISIBILITY)
- Consequence:
- IF THIS WERE TO OCCUR, DRIVER VISIBILITY COULD BE REDUCED, WHICH COULD RESULT IN A VEHICLE CRASH.
- Remedy:
- DEALERS WILL INSTALL A NEW WIPER CRANK ARM, DRIVER'S SIDE LINK, AND A CRANK ARM NUT. THE RECALL BEGAN O OCTOBER 13, 2008. OWNERS MAY CONTACT BUICK AT 1-866-608-8080, GMC AT 1-866-996-9463, SATURN AT 1-800-972-8876, OR THROUGH THEIR WEBSITE AT HTTP://WWW.GMOWNERCENTER.COM.

Recall campaign 08V441000
Safety recall 08V441000
- Report date
- Component:
- Not available in the source record
- Consequence:
- THIS MAY CAUSE OTHER ELECTRICAL FEATURES TO MALFUNCTION, CREATE AN ODOR, OR CAUSE SMOKE INCREASING THE RISK OF A FIRE.
- Remedy:
- DEALERS WILL INSTALL A WIRE HARNESS WITH AN IN-LINE FUSE FREE OF CHARGE. THE RECALL BEGAN ON SEPTEMBER 12, 2008. Recall campaign 10V240000
Safety recall 10V240000
- Report date
- Component:
- Not available in the source record
- Consequence:
- IT IS POSSIBLE FOR THE HEATED WASHER MODULE TO IGNITE AND A FIRE MAY OCCUR.
- Remedy:
- DEALERS WILL PERMANENTLY DISABLE AND REMOVE THE HEATED WASHER FLUID MODULE. AN UPDATED PAGE FOR THE OWNER MANUAL WILL BE PROVIDED AND INSERTED IN THE OWNER MANUAL TO DOCUMENT THAT THE FEATURE HAS BEEN PERMANENTLY DISABLED AND REMOVED FROM THE VEHICLE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ON JUNE 11, 2010. Recall campaign 14V118000
Airbags
- Report date
- Component:
- Airbags (AIR BAGS)
- Consequence:
- Failure of the side impact air bags and seat belt pretensioners to deploy in a crash increase the risk of injury to the driver and front seat occupant.
- Remedy:
- GM will notify owners, and dealers will replace the affected harness connections with soldered connections, free of charge. The recall began on June 16, 2014. Recall campaign 15V415000
Body / frame
- Report date
- Component:
- Body / frame (STRUCTURE)
- Consequence:
- If the open liftgate unexpectedly falls, it may strike a person, increasing their risk of injury.
- Remedy:
- GM will notify owners, and dealers will update the software for the power liftgate actuator motor control unit so that the motor will prevent the rapid closing of the lift gate, free of charge. The recall began on November 15, 2016. Frequently asked questions
What are the most common problems on the 2008 GMC Acadia?
Owners named Transmission / driveline most often — 211 of 852 reports (25%). That is the NHTSA file, not a diagnosis of every vehicle.
Are there recalls for the 2008 GMC Acadia?
NHTSA lists 5 safety recall campaigns. They were filed about Glass / wipers / cameras, Airbags, and Body / frame. Check the VIN at nhtsa.gov; a campaign on this page can still be open on a specific vehicle.
What should I inspect before buying a 2008 GMC Acadia?
Look up the VIN for open recalls. Have a shop drive it and check the transmission: hard or delayed shifts, burnt-smelling fluid, and 4WD engagement if equipped. Then skim owner filings for the same symptom and take that list to a mechanic.
Does a high complaint count mean I should skip this year?
No. Counts are reports people chose to file and they are not adjusted for sales volume. YearTell does not publish scores or a list of years to skip. Inspect the vehicle.
